Sepi

Name
  TSepiMemberBuilder

Parent
  SepiCompilerUtils

Class Hierarchy
  TObject

Visibility
  PUBLIC

Description
  Classe de base pour les constructeurs de membres de type composites

Members
  Fields
 
Field Description
FCurrentNode (-) Noeud courant pour les erreurs
FName (-) Nom du membre à construire
FOwner (-) Propriétaire du membre à construire
FOwnerClass (-) Classe propriétaire (si applicable)
FOwnerIntf (-) Interface propriétaire (si applicable)
FOwnerRecord (-) Record propriétaire (si applicable)
FOwnerType (-) Type propriétaire (si applicable)

Methods
 
Method Description
Build (+) Construit le membre
Create (+) Crée un nouveau constructeur de membre
LookForMember (#) Cherche un membre du type englobant d'après son nom
LookForMemberOrError (#) Cherche un membre du type englobant d'après son nom
MakeError (#) Produit un message d'erreur

Properties
 
Property Description
CurrentNode (+) Noeud courant pour les erreurs
NAME (+) Nom du membre à construire
Owner (+) Propriétaire du membre à construire
OwnerClass (#) Classe propriétaire (si applicable)
OwnerIntf (#) Interface propriétaire (si applicable)
OwnerRecord (#) Record propriétaire (si applicable)
OwnerType (#) Type propriétaire (si applicable)


Legend
 
Symbol Visibility
- Private
# Protected
+ Public
* Published
A Automated
S Strict

Sepi


Copyright (c) 2006-2010 Sébastien Doeraene
Created with DelphiCodeToDoc. To obtain the latest revision, please visit http://dephicodetodoc.sourceforge.net/